Verizon Connect Strengths, Domain Expertise, and Key Differentiators

Verizon Connect is guiding a connected world on the go by automating, optimizing, and revolutionizing the way people, vehicles, and things move through the world. Verizon Connect's full suite of industry-defining solutions and services put innovation, automation, and connected data to work for customers and help them be safer, more efficient, and more productive.

The Verizon Connect portfolio of solutions and services includes comprehensive fleet and mobile workforce management software platforms, embedded OEM hardware, and Hum by Verizon, a connected vehicle device that helps create a safer, smarter and more connected driving experience for consumers.

Verizon Connect Recent Developments

Verizon Connect introduced a compact, discreet asset tracking solution that is easy to conceal, self-install, and self-manage, to help Reveal customers reduce theft, improve equipment utilization and billing, and reduce equipment downtime with a replaceable battery.

In September 2019, Verizon Connect launched a new immobilization tool for its Verizon Connect Reveal, helping fleets prevent unauthorized use of vehicles and aid in the recovery of stolen vehicles. The same month it launched a dispatch solution for field service fleets that integrates with its Reveal cloud-based telematics platform. Field Service Dispatch brings vehicle location data together with technician status updates to help fleet managers improve dispatching and scheduling.

In July 2019, Verizon Connect launched the Navigation Mobile App for Verizon Connect Reveal. The app works with the Verizon Connect Reveal platform to give drivers directions based on their vehicle and load types to reduce miles driven and improve safety. The company expects the new app will have a positive impact on fleet and driver efficiency.

Verizon Connect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A) Activities

Verizon Telematics acquired Movildata Internacional, a Murcia, Spain-based provider of commercial fleet management solutions. Movildata employees have joined the Verizon Telematics team and will continue to drive sales and support for its current fleet management products.

In 2016, Verizion Connect acquired Fleetmatics Group, a global provider of fleet and mobile workforce management solutions. The deal made Fleetmatics a part of Verizon Telematics, a subsidiary of the telco that focuses on fleet management, mobile workforce solutions and IoT. It’s part of a short spate of acquisitions that Verizon has been making in 2016 to expand those operations: about six weeks before, Verizon Telematics announced that it would acquire Telogis.

Verizon has the largest GPS fleet management system globally with over 1.9 million vehicles managed through over 80,000 customers. Some of its most recent customers are Allegiant Electric, Domino’s, Maple Hill Lawn & Garden, Gravel Conveyors Inc., and others. Among its other customers are GM, Pepsi, Roi, Joyride Coffee, Zayo, Hexagon Leasing, DiPinto International Logistics, FreshDirect, and 1-800-GOT-JUNK. United Private Car Inc. and many more.

Verizon Connect Market Opportunities, M&A and Geo Expansions

Verizon Connect announced the European expansion of Reveal EV capabilities in addition to the new Electric Vehicle Suitability Tool. The EV Suitability Tool shows customers how converting to electric vehicles (EVs) can help them achieve cost reduction while reaching their sustainability goals. The easy-to-read dashboard highlights which of their vehicles can be replaced by EVs and provides graphical data to support these recommendations. No input by the customers is required, as the analysis is done automatically.

In April 2021, Peter Mitchell has been appointed general manager of Verizon Connect, an integral part of Verizon Business’ product portfolio. Mitchell expanded his role as the company’s chief technology officer.

Verizon Connect Risks and Challenges

Verizon Connect division is formed in part from the $2.4 billion acquisition of Fleetmatics, which Verizon bought in 2016 along with Telogis, Sensity Systems, and LQD Wifi to beef up its mobile device connectivity services.

Verizon Connect Ecosystem, Partners, Resellers and SI

The launch of Verizon Connect in Italy marks the completed integration of Visirun under a single, combined brand. Verizon Connect offers customers globally a one-stop approach to fleet management software solutions and services.

In April 2019, Verizon Connect has partnered with Iveco, manufacturer of commercial and industrial vehicles in the European Union, to provide its fleet customers with telematics and a mobile workforce management software platform. The Verizon Connect Fleet and Workforce offerings will provide vehicle and driver information that businesses of any size can use to optimize their mobile business, the companies say. Iveco fleet management by Verizon Connect is available now in new Iveco Daily light commercial vehicles.

Verizon Connect has Software Integration Partners like Trimble, C.H. Robinson, Comdata, a FLEETCOR company, Fuel Tax Agreement, Descartes MacroPoint, FLEETCOR, FourKites, and many more.
